WebA rock hammer is one of the tools gemologists use for cutting rough stones. Photo by GorissenM. Licensed under CC By-SA 2.0. The Rock Hammer. The quickest way to reduce a large rock to smaller pieces is with a rock hammer. As obvious as this sounds, many people slave over their saws when a few quick blows from a rock hammer would do the job.
